About This Dive Spot
Brestova is situated north of Rabac and features a prominent cliff adorned with numerous crevices and small caves. Access to this dive site is exclusively by boat. The reef wall is abundant in marine life, providing opportunities to observe species such as lobsters, cuttlefish, octopuses, scorpionfish, and conger eels.
